Xema Borras (trombone) and Diana Miguel de Lauzon (piano) offer a program consisting of: Elegy for a Mippy (L. Bernstein), Concerto (L. Grondahl), Sonata 'Vox Gabrielli (Sileck), Choral, Cadence et Fugato (H. Dutilleux) and Selections of Jazz with Guitar.
In addition to being performers, they both also develop a role as teacher, currently at the Conservatory of Music of the Balearic Islands, Xema Borras as tenured professor of trombone and Diana Miguel de Lauzon as head of piano.
The concert is part of the cycle Concerts of Teachers at the Conservatory of Music of the Balearic Islands 2013, organized by the teachers themselves in collaboration with the Conservatory, Alma Concerts and the International Music Festival Deia.
